Artist Traci Bautista


Traci is creative director and owner of treiC Designs. She has a Bachelor of Science degree from Woodbury University, with a major in Graphic Design and Marketing. Prior to becoming a full-time artist, Traci Bautista held jobs as a graphic designer, event planner, marketing director, professional cheerleader, elementary art history teacher, fashion designer, Web designer, and tradeshow manager – just to name a few. Experiences that she gained in these positions, coupled with her innate drive to explore and create without boundaries are what contribute to her growing success as a collage and mixed media artist.

Traci travels across the country and internationally to offer workshops and classes on handmade books, art journals, mixed-media collage, and surface design. Combining her love of designing clothes, doodling and lettering, Traci creates vibrantly colored handmade journals, custom handbags and paintings that are layered with rich textures of stained papers, painted sewn fabric, “girlie glam” ink drawings and free style lettering. Her artwork has been featured in Somerset Studio, Altered Couture, cloth.paper.scissors, Creative TECHniques, Belle Armoire and various books. She has been a regular guest artist on HGTV & DIY Network Craft Lab. Traci is the author of, Collage Unleashed, and writes a regular column called Creativity Unleashed in Somerset Studio Magazine. Fabric intarsia: Felt-inlay patchwork

feltI’m enthralled. It never occurred to me that it’s possible to create inlay with fabric — much as woodcrafters do with veneer. And yet this needlework technique has been around at least since the 14th century! I quite like this one. Even though the entire time i was looking at it as a horizontal. In fact i'd had enough of it and thought of it as a failure. But i thought i'd take a picture of it and upload it to istockphoto anyway in case someone wanted to use it for grunge texture, or something like that. But when viewing it vertical like this, i really like it.

I planned on painting shapes, like i did for the bodhi tree, but in this case i'd paint repetitive triangles, thinking of sails. It really wasn't abstract enough in the beginning so i kept adding and subtracting layers many times and made some scratches and texture lines with a watercolor pencils until finally i was just through with it. It wasn't going where i'd hoped it would.

Looking at it vertical is a really happy accident.
